Due to increasing workload, we are currently seeking a Building Surveyor in our Edinburgh or Glasgow office, assisting our established building surveying team. You will carry out the day-to-day duties of a Building Surveyor on allocated projects, assist the management team with the mentoring of junior staff and resource management, and work towards designated RICS APC route.
This role provides a challenging and rewarding opportunity to develop within a dynamic team working on a broad range of both professional and project related work for both public and private sector clients, supported by a medium-sized multi-professional consultancy.

And as a Building Surveyor with Bellrock, you’ll do it by…
- Measured surveys: preparation of floor plans, elevations, and details on AutoCAD (must be AutoCAD proficient).
- Building surveys: condition surveys, schedules of condition, defects diagnosis inspections, detailed measured surveys.
- Project building surveying: design including the preparation of AutoCAD drawings, preparation of statutory consent applications, preparation of tender documents, project monitoring and contract administration.
- Building pathology: identifying building defects and failures and developing solutions including advice on estimated costs and programme.
- Property management: preparation of planned maintenance programmes including elemental cost preparation.
- CDM services (desirable but not essential) preparation of pre-construction information and health and safety files.
